Output fadb08c63a79eb215be32bf9687a77b694633e4081a63376c018d623c772761a:1

value
839124
script pubkey
OP_0 OP_PUSHBYTES_20 b2120222991b0ebf57ff6787cb6a56f6cecc47ba
address
bc1qkgfqyg5erv8t74llv7ruk6jk7m8vc3a64nun2a
transaction
fadb08c63a79eb215be32bf9687a77b694633e4081a63376c018d623c772761a
confirmations
128053
spent
true